4.4.8 Flow rate adjustment

1.

From the MAINTENANCE/DIAG. menu select
START UP

and press Enter

2.

First, the system automatically primes both the
calibration and reactivation tubes.

3.

Check that there are no air bubbles in the reagent
tubes for reactivation and auto calibration.

4.

The next step allows you to regulate the sample
flow rate on each measurement channel. The name
of the channel to regulate is displayed (the default
name of Sample 1 for channel 1 is illustrated left).

5.

The analyzer automatically empties and refills the
overflow vessel to determine the flow rate which is
displayed on screen.

6.

The flow rate for each channel should be 6 to 9
L/hour.

7.

Using a screwdriver, regulate the channel’s sample
flow by turning counter-clockwise to increase the
flow rate or clockwise to decrease the flow rate.

8.

The process is repeated until the flow is correctly
regulated for the channel. At this point select OK.

9.

The system then allows you to regulate the next
channel until all flow rates have been set for the
configured channels.

10.

Once all flow rates for the configured channels have
been set, an Action completed message will be
displayed.

11.

Select Esc to exit and complete the process.
